… More »"At long last, the Final Selection has arrived! Kahoko and her fellow contestants take the stage, knowing that only one of them can win. For Kahoko, there's even more pressure: this is the first time she'll perform without magical assistance. But after the competition, an even greater challenge lies ahead: deciding what to do next. Is music--and love--in the future for Kahoko and her friends?" -- from publisher's web site.
